Wade Pfau Sequence of Returns Risk is a little talked about, but critical, risk in retirement. Sequence of Returns Risk, or Sequence Risk for short, is the risk that you will need to take distributions from your investment portfolio during periods where the market has recently gone down.

Box: 1149 Tel: 054 958 821, 054 958 634, 054 958 541 ...Nov 26, 2023 · Dr. Pfau writes that in the early 1980s, you would have thought it was a great time to retire because interest rates were so high. But for new retirees then, it would have been hard to accumulate much wealth in the years preceding retirement because of the abysmal stock markets of the 1970s and early 1980s. He is a co-founder of the Retirement Income Style Awareness tool and a co-host of the Retire with Style podcast.Wade Pfau Noted financial advisor and historian William Bernstein makes a compelling case for stocks in his e-book Deep Risk: How History Informs Portfolio Design. In the introduction, Bernstein begins by offering an operational definition of risk. Risk is the size of real capital loss times the duration of real capital loss.
